Drug-likeness

Descriptor-based ADME screening flags from SMILES. These are not experimental toxicity results.

Permeability proxy Check

Estimated from TPSA and LogP only: TPSA ≤ 90 Ų and −1 ≤ LogP ≤ 5 are treated as a favorable small-molecule permeability screen.

  • TPSA ≤ 90 Ų 100.5
  • −1 ≤ LogP ≤ 5 4.54
Lipinski's Rule of Five Pass 1 violation
  • MW ≤ 500 Da 713.3
  • LogP ≤ 5 4.54
  • H-bond donors ≤ 5 0
  • H-bond acceptors ≤ 10 10
Veber's rules Fail
  • Rotatable bonds ≤ 10 13
  • TPSA ≤ 140 Ų 100.5
PAINS Clean

No PAINS structural alerts detected.
